FATE to organise ‘Tax Fair’ at LUMS on November 23

byM. Faizan
05/11/2015
in Breaking News, Islamabad, Latest News
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

Islamabad: Federal Board of Revenue’s (FBR) Facilitation and Taxpayers Education (FATE) will hold a “Tax Fair” to educate the students at Lahore University of Management Sciences (LUMS) on November 23, 2015.

Member FATE Nadeem Dar and Chairman FBR Tariq Bajwa will be the chief guest at the event.

The daylong ‘Tax Fair’ will provide a number of informative, educational and dialogue-driven activities, including speeches, group discussions, stalls, mock theatres and a question answer session between FBR officers and students.

The youth will be informed about the importance of taxes and urged to play their role to promote the tax culture.
